A Comprehensive Jamb Subjects Combinations For All Tertiary Institution.

Faculty of Administration

1. Accountancy:
Use of English, Mathematics, Economics and any other Social Science subject.

2. Banking and Finance:
Use of English, Mathematics, Economics, plus one of Government and Geography.

3. Business Administration:
Use of English, Mathematics, Economics plus one of Government and Geography.

4. Business Management:
Use of English, Mathematics, Economics plus one of Government and Geography.

5. Cooperative and Rural Development:
Use of English, Mathematics, Economics plus one other subject.

6. Human Resources Management:
Use of English, Economics, Government and any other relevant subjects.
7. Industrial Relations:
Use of English, Mathematics, Economics plus one other relevant subject.

8. Insurance:
English, Mathematics, Economics and one other subject.

9. International Relations:
Use of English, Economics, Literature in English and Geography/Government/History.

10. Marketing:
Use of English,Mathematics, Economics plus one other relevant Subject.

11. Mass Communication:
Use of English, Literature in English, Economics and Government.

12. Tourism:
English, Mathematics, Economics and any other subject.

Faculty of Agriculture

1. Agriculture:
English, Chemistry, Biology/Agriculture and any one of Physics and Mathematics.

2. Agricultural Economics:
English Language, Chemistry, Biology/ Agricultural Science and Mathematics or Physics.

3. Agricultural Engineering:
Use of English, Mathematics, Physics and Chemistry.

4. Agricultural Extension:
English, Chemistry, Biology/Agricultural Science plus Mathematics or Physics.

5. Agronomy:
English, Chemistry, Biology or Agriculture and Physics or Mathematics.

6. Animal Production and Science:
Use of English, Chemistry, Biology/Agric Science and Physics/Mathematics.

7. Crop Production and Science:
English, Chemistry, Biology/Agriculture and Mathematics or Physics.

8. Fisheries:
Use of English, Chemistry, Biology/Agricultural Science and any other Science subject.

9. Food Science and Technology:
Use of English, Chemistry, Mathematics / Physics and Agricultural Science.

10. Forestry:
Use of English, Chemistry, Biology or Agriculture and Physics or Mathematics.

11. Home Science:
Use of English, Chemistry, Biology or Agriculture and Mathematics or Physics.

12. Nutrition and Dietetics:
Use of English, Chemistry, Biology/Agriculture and Mathematics/Physics.

13. Soil Science:
English, Chemistry, Biology or Agricultural Science plus Mathematics or Physics.

Faculty of Arts and Humanities

1. Christian Religious Studies:
Use of English, two Arts subjects including Christian Religious Knowledge and any other subject.

2. English and Literary Studies:
Use of English, Literature in English, one other Arts subject and another Arts or Social Science subject.

3. Fine and Applied Arts:
Use of English Language, Fine Art and two other Arts subjects or Social Science subject.

4. Islamic Studies:
Use of English, Islamic Religious Studies plus two other Arts subjects.

5. Languages and Linguistics:
Use of English, One Arts subject and two other subjects.

6. Literature in English:
Use of English, Literature-in-English, one other Arts subject and another Arts or Social Science subject.

7. French:
English, French and any other two subjects from Arts and Social Sciences.

8. Hausa:
English, Hausa, Lit in English and any of Economics, Government, History and Arabic.

9. History:
Use of English, History and any other two subjects from Arts and Social Sciences.

10. History and International Studies:
Use of English, History/Government and any other two subjects from Arts & Social Science.

11. Igbo:
English, Igbo and two subjects from Arts and social Sciences.

12. Linguistics:
English, Any Language and two other subjects.

13. Mass Communication:
Use of English, Any three Arts and Social Science subjects.
14. Music:
Use of English, Music, one other Arts subject plus any other subject.

15. Theatre Arts:
Use of English, Literature in English and two other relevant subjects.

16. Yoruba:
Use of English, Yoruba and two other subjects in Arts or Social Sciences.

Faculty of Education

1. Adult Education:
Use of English, Government/History, one Social Science subject, and any other subject.

2. Agricultural Science and Education:
Use of English, Any three subjects from Chemistry, Biology, Agriculture, Physics, Economics, Geography and Mathematics.

3. Computer Education:
Use of English, Mathematics, Economics/Commerce plus one of Chemistry/Physics/Biology.

4. Education and Accountancy:
Use of English, Mathematics, Economics plus any Social Science subject.

5. Education and Biology:
Use of English, Biology and two other subjects from Chemistry, Mathematics and Physics.

6. Education and Chemistry:
Use of English, Chemistry and two other subjects chosen from Physics, Biology and Mathematics.

7. Education and Christian Religious Studies:
Use of English, Two Arts subjects including Christian Religious studies and one other subject.

8. Education and Computer Science:
Use of English, Mathematics, Physics and one of Biology, Chemistry and Geography/Physics.

9. Education and Economics:
Use of English, Economics, Mathematics and one other subject from Geography/Physics, History, Government and Lit. in English.

10. Education and English Language:
Use of English, Literature in English and one Arts and any other subjects.

11. Education and Mathematics:
Use of English, Mathematics and any two of the following Science subjects: Physics, Chemistry and Biology.

12. Education and Physics:
Use of English, Physics, Mathematics or Chemistry plus one other subject.

13. Education Arts:
Use of English, Subject of specialization and any two Arts subjects.

14. Guidance and Counseling:
Use of English, Any three subjects.

15. Health Education:
Use of English, and three other relevant subjects.

16. Human Kinetics:
Use of English, and three other relevant subjects.

17. Physical and Health Education:
Use of English, Biology and any two relevant subjects.

18. Vocational and Technical Education:
Use of English, Technical Drawing, a subject of specialization and Mathematics or Physics.

Faculty of Engineering

1. Agricultural and Bio-Resources Engineering:
Use of English, Mathematics, Chemistry and Physics.

2. Civil Engineering:
Use of English, Mathematics, Physics and Chemistry.

3. Chemical Engineering:
Use of English, Mathematics, Physics and Chemistry.

4. Computer Engineering:
Use of English, Mathematics, Physics and Chemistry.

5. Electrical Engineering:
Use of English, Mathematics, Physics and Chemistry.

6. Electronic Engineering:
Use of English, Mathematics, Physics and Chemistry.

7. Marine Engineering:
Use of English, Mathematics, Physics and Chemistry.

8. Mechanical Engineering:
Use of English, Mathematics, Physics and Chemistry.

9. Mechatronics Engineering:
Use of English, Physics, Chemistry and Mathematics.

10. Metallurgical and Materials Engineering:
Use of English, Mathematics, Physics and Chemistry.

11. Petroleum and Gas Engineering:
Use of English, Mathematics, Physics and Chemistry.

12. Production and Industrial Engineering:
Use of English, Mathematics, Physics and Chemistry.

13. Structural Engineering:
Use of English, Mathematics, Physics and Chemistry.

14. Systems Engineering:
Use of English, Mathematics, Physics and Chemistry.

Faculty of Environmental Sciences and Technology

1. Architecture:
English, Physics, Mathematics, and any of Chemistry, Geography, Art, Biology and Economics.

2. Building:
Use of English, Physics, Mathematics, Chemistry.

3. Estate Management:
Use of English, Mathematics, Economics and one other subject.

4. Quantity Surveying:
Use of English, Physics, Mathematics, and any of Chemistry, Geography, Art, Biology and Economics.

5. Surveying and Geoinformatics:
Use of English, Physics, Mathematics, and any of Chemistry, Geography, Art, Biology and Economics.

6. Urban and Regional Planning:
English, Mathematics, Geography and one of Economics, Physics, Chemistry.

Faculty of Law

1. Civil Law:
English, Any three Arts or Social Science subjects.

2. Common Law:
English, Literature-in-English and any two other Arts/or Social Science subjects.

3. Criminology And Security Studies:
English, Any three subjects.

4. Islamic / Sharia Law:
English, Any three Arts or Social Science subjects including Arabic or Islamic Studies.

5. Law:
English, Any three Arts or Social Science subjects.

Faculty of Medical, Pharmaceutical and Health Sciences

1. Anatomy:
English, Mathematics, Biology and Chemistry or Physics.

2. Dentistry:
Use of English, Chemistry, Biology and one Science subject.

3. Medical Laboratory Science:
English Language, Physics, Chemistry and Biology.

4. Medical Rehabilitation:
Use of English, Physics, Chemistry and Biology.

5. Medicine and Surgery:
Use of English, Biology, Physics and Chemistry.

6. Nursing:
Use of English, Physics, Biology and Chemistry.

7. Pharmacy:
Use of English, Biology, Physics and Chemistry.

8. Physiology:
Use of English, Biology, Physics and Chemistry.

9. Physiotherapy:
Use of English, Biology, Physics and Chemistry.

10. Radiography:
Use of English, Biology, Physics and Chemistry.

11. Veterinary Medicine:
Use of English, Biology, Physics and Chemistry.

Faculty of Sciences

1. Biochemistry:
Use of English, Biology, Chemistry, and Physics.

2. Biological Sciences:
Use of English, Biology, Chemistry and Physics or Mathematics.

3. Botany:
Use of English, Biology, Chemistry and any other Science subject.

4. Chemistry:
Use of English, Chemistry and two of Physics, Biology and Mathematics.

5. Computer Science:
Use of English, Mathematics, Physics, and one of Biology, Chemistry, Agricultural Science, Economics and Geography.

6. Geology:
Use of English and any three Chemistry, Physics, Mathematics, Biology and Geography.

7. Industrial Chemistry:
Use of English, Chemistry, Mathematics and any of Physics/Biology/Agricultural Science.

8. Industrial Mathematics:
Use of English, Mathematics and any two of Physics, Chemistry, Economics, Biology and Agricultural Science.

9. Mathematics:
Use of English, Mathematics and any two of Physics, Chemistry and Economics or Geography.

10. Microbiology:
Use of English, Biology, Chemistry and either Physics.

11. Physics:
Use of English, Physics, Mathematics and Chemistry or Biology.

12. Plant Science and Biotechnology:
Use of English, Biology, Chemistry and any other Science subject.

13. Pure and Applied Mathematics:
Use of English, Mathematics, Physics and Biology or Agricultural Science or Chemistry or Geography.

14. Statistics:
Use of English, Mathematics and any two of Physics, Chemistry and Economics.

15. Zoology:
Use of English, Biology and any two of Physics, Chemistry and Mathematics.

Faculty of Social and Management Sciences

1. Demography and Social Statistics:
Use of English, Mathematics, Economics/Geography and any other subject.

2. Economics:
Use of English, Mathematics, Economics and any of Government, History, Geography, Literature in English, French and CRK/IRK.

3. Geography:
Use of English, Geography and two other Arts or Social Science subjects.

4. Library Science:
Use of English and Any three Arts or Social Science subjects.

5. Mass Communication:
Use of English, and any three from Arts or Social Science subjects.

6. Philosophy:
Use of English, Government and any other two subjects.

7. Political Science:
Use of English, Government or History plus two other Social Science/Arts subjects.

8. Psychology:
Use of English, and any three subjects from Arts or Social Science.

9. Public Administration:
Use of English, Mathematics, Economics and any other subject.

10. Religious Studies:
Use of English Language, CRK/IRS and any two other subjects.

11. Social Works:
Use of English Language, Mathematics, Economics/Geography and any other subject.
